My gripe with how they did Killmongers philosophy in this movie was they put his quest for liberation on the adversarial side. They couched his messages neatly into how the real Black Panther Party would like to resist and liberate peopls but in this instance on a fantasy level and aligned Killmongers passion for his people with hatred, sub-textually aligning the works of the real black panthers with the same. It kinda irks me that it echoes to young generations that what the BPP did was somehow, “bad”, because of course we dont see what inspired Killmonger we just see his anger, so his POV was limited to the audience. Its interesting how they juxtaposed all this social commentery into this movie.
Also I didn't buy that he was his hot head brash thinking adversary full of hatred and anger once he assumed the kingdom that part was rushed (maybe the 3 hour version has more development for the character here) Killmonger was much to clever and cocky, ruthless but more measured than how they depicted him in the end.
